Transcat, Inc. (NASDAQ:TRNS) Shares Purchased by Rice Hall James & Associates LLC

Rice Hall James & Associates LLC increased its stake in shares of Transcat, Inc. (NASDAQ:TRNSFree Report) by 40.2%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 35,685 shares of the scientific and technical instruments company’s stock after purchasing an additional 10,238 shares during the period. Rice Hall James & Associates LLC owned 0.39% of Transcat worth $3,773,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Transcat (NASDAQ:TRNSG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Monday, January 27th. The scientific and technical instruments company reported $0.45 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.38 by $0.07. Transcat had a net margin of 6.22% and a return on equity of 7.23%.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m posted $0.56 earnings per share. On average, analysts anticipate that Transcat, Inc. will post 2.3 EPS for the current year.

About Transcat

(Free Report)

Transcat, Inc provides calibration and laboratory instrument services in the United States, Canada, and internationally. It operates through two segments: Service and Distribution. The Service segment offers calibration, repair, inspection, analytical qualification, preventative maintenance, consulting, and other related services.
